About

Kalinka Branco is a leading researcher in autonomous systems and distributed decision-making, with a focus on safe mission planning for multi-agent environments. Her work centers on Markov Decision Processes (MDPs) as a framework for sequential decision-making under uncertainty, where she has pioneered self-adaptive reward tuning mechanisms to ensure robust and safe coordination among multiple agents. Her 2020 paper on reward tuning for self-adaptive policies in MDP-based distributed decision-making (3 citations) addresses critical challenges in enabling autonomous agents to dynamically adjust their behavior in complex, real-world scenarios, such as drone swarms or robotic teams.
